    Since our first session with Steven and with the homework exercises we’ve been doing consistently, we’ve been able to rebalance the leadership dynamics in our home and introduce much-needed structure and rules. The difference in Miki’s behavior has been remarkable—he is so much calmer and more responsive.

    What we appreciate most is that this training is done entirely out of love and focuses on canine communication rather than a punishment/reward system. It has helped us better understand Miki’s needs and how to guide him in a way that makes him feel secure and balanced.

    This training is truly beneficial for anyone willing to put in the work. Consistency with the exercises is key, but it is absolutely worth it. We feel like we have a new dog, and we couldn’t be happier with the results. Highly recommend Steven!

    I thought that getting my four-year-old Cavapoo her own puppy would help with keeping her company when I would be at work or go out. The new puppy was a rescue, and it was an adjustment for all of us. Over the last year, these two amazing individual dogs started to rub off on each other in negative ways surrounding separation anxiety and excessive barking, to the point that even if I just walk toward the front door the barking is so bad it sounds like actual screaming. The barking was relentless for hours, with no break in between, when I would not be home. They began being triggered by every single noise they heard even if they were sitting next to me on the couch. I tried other dog trainers with no success until we met Steve. Steve’s consultation doesn’t just include explaining to you what the process will be like but he spends hours training you on how to regain respect and your alpha status again, as well as how to “speak canine” to your dogs. The way in which he taught me to communicate is different than anything I ever knew before, including from the trainers that I used in 2019 when I got my first dog. In just a couple of hours there were already significant obvious improvements in their behaviors. These situations are not only frustrating for owners, but no dog lover wants to know that their babies are suffering emotionally with anxiety and it can make you feel very helpless. I asked Steve if he taught Cesar Milan everything he knows because Steve is the first person I’ve ever seen connect with dogs the way I’ve seen Cesar for years watching him on TV. I’ve wasted money on people who truly had no effect, but I wasn’t ready to give up regardless of cost. You have to realize that this is an investment. Bark Buster is there for you indefinitely for the rest of your fur babies lives, and to support you as an owner too. I cannot say enough about my experience so far and would recommend 10 out of 10, all day! My best advice is, if you feel like things are hopeless, no matter what you’ve tried, don’t give up. Bark Busters absolutely will make it possible for you and your pet(s) to live a very happy and healthy life together!

    My husband and I just moved here to Manhattan from the Suburbs in the Bay Area California. Our pup Sammy has been exposed to a lot of major change in just one month, and we have never used a dog training service before. Sammy's environment has changed from a lot more space to a much smaller one, and he is now being exposed to a lot more dogs and people.

    In the two weeks since we have moved to Manhattan, Sammy's separation anxiety and anxiety due to the smallest noise, movement or not even being in the same room with us, definitely heightened. Sammy would bark for hours until he would exhaust himself.

    Sammy also has some prior behavioral issues that we never helped to correct, such as jumping on people, barking at other dogs, and boundary issues-including following us everywhere, jumping and sleeping on furniture he is not supposed to and going into rooms he is not allowed in.

    In just a few hours of reaching out to Bark Busters, I received a phone call and had a brief evaluation of Sammy over the phone. We were given information about the training process and information about Sarah, and we were given a training appointment for the next day (Saturday) which worked perfectly for our schedule.

    In just the couple hours that Sarah was in our home, she went straight to work! We saw results immediately! Honestly, my husband and I were in awe. Sarah is definitely an expert in her field. She really observed Sammy's behavior, asked us a plethora of questions, about our schedules, home environment and the problem areas we wanted to address moving forward.

    Sarah was direct with us and really went over training exercises repetitively until both my husband and I were comfortable doing them on our own and the results were immediate. In just 24 hours, we have seen a huge change in Sammy. My husband and I will continue with the training here at home, but Sarah has reassured that we have a lifetime access to her expertise and services via phone, email and even home visits.

    In just one day, Sammy has listened to us when we stop him from coming into our bedroom.
    He hasn't barked in the apartment at all today, and we will observe tomorrow, when the construction noise continues, but I know I have the tools to practice keeping Sammy's anxiety at bay. Sammy also has not urinated anywhere in the apartment when he gets frustrated if we leave the room.

    She really helped my husband and I understand Sammy's needs as well as understand that we are in control, not Sammy and provided us with tools to be confident and not confrontational with Sammy.

    We just want to thank Sarah for all her positive and upbeat help. We know that it will be a process, but we are excited to have Sarah's help moving forward. We definitely would recommend her services to others. Thank you so much Sarah! We greatly appreciate everything!
